Monitoring your students' progress is crucial for managing your online school. Whether it's to track their interaction with your content or to ensure they meet the formal requirements of a specific certification (such as spending a minimum amount of time in a course), it's important to have the ability to delve into their statistics when necessary.
You can review which courses, programs, and learning activities your users have completed, as well as how much time they have spent on each section and learning unit.
How to view a user’s progress
1. Go to Users → All users.
2. Select the user you want to review.
3. In the User details panel, click on products.
4. You’ll see all progress-related information for each product the user is enrolled in.
From here, you can:
- View completed sections, courses, and programs
- Check the time spent on each activity and the total time spent on the product
- See the course start and end dates
- Export progress reports based on:
- Time spent per date
- Time spent per activity
- Score
If a product or learning activity has been marked as completed manually, you’ll see a “Completed (Manually)” indication under the Completion column. For more details, refer to the relevant help article.

Understand unenrolled or expired access
If you see the following "unenrolled/expired" red tag on the users' card, it means that:

a) You have set up an expiration date for this course, and their course access has expired.
b) They have been manually unenrolled from the course.
c) They have lost access as they stopped paying for their installment plan (canceled or card issues).
d) Or they have lost access as they stopped paying for their subscription plan.
Hover over the unenrolled status to see the reason.
